CM Yogi Adityanath Reviews Rain Shelters in Gorakhpur, Announces Statewide Relief Measures for Needy

He also distributed woollen clothes to people in need, reaffirming the government’s commitment to welfare-focused governance.

CM Yogi Adityanath on Friday said that comprehensive directions have been issued to all districts in Uttar Pradesh to strengthen relief measures for the poor and homeless, especially during adverse weather conditions.

CM Yogi Adityanath Reviews Rain Shelters in Gorakhpur

Speaking in Gorakhpur, the Chief Minister said the state government has instructed authorities to set up rain shelters on a large scale, ensure distribution of woollen clothes and blankets to the needy, and light bonfires at public places to provide warmth and protection.

Inspection of Rain Shelters in Gorakhpur

CM Yogi Adityanath said he personally inspected rain shelters in Bargadwa and Rapti Nagar during his visit to Gorakhpur. He also distributed woollen clothes to people in need, reaffirming the government’s commitment to welfare-focused governance.

According to the Chief Minister, 19 rain shelters are currently operational within the Gorakhpur metropolitan area, offering temporary accommodation to more than 1,000 needy people, many of whom were earlier forced to live on sidewalks and near railway tracks.

Safe and Organised Facilities

The Chief Minister emphasised that all rain shelters are safe, well-managed and functioning in an organised manner. He added that arrangements for food, bedding and basic facilities are being ensured so that vulnerable sections of society are protected during harsh weather.

Focus on Dignity and Care

CM Yogi Adityanath said the state government’s priority is to ensure that no poor or homeless person is left without support, particularly during winter and rainy conditions. He directed district administrations to remain alert and proactive in identifying those in need and extending timely assistance.
